Welcome. This project was created as part of my honours year at University. This project was created to investigate language learning through games, with a focus on Scottish Gaelic. This project took the form of a conceptual game where the player would run a post office on an island, and interact with different characters and develop their Gaelic skills through conversations with the NPCs.

ABOUT

My project is focused around the idea of learning a language through games, in order to preserve native languages. I will be looking at ways to use art style to influence opinion and translate the feeling of learning a language and then “unlocking” a culture.

 This will be realised through the medium of concepting for a hypothetical game, including character and environment design. The game will have the player working in a post office and navigating interactions with the characters in Gaelic. It will start out simple and progressively become harder as the player is introduced to different concepts within the language. The characters will each have distinct personalities, and some will be more willing to speak English than others, simulating complete immersion into a language and culture. 

The game currently exists conceptually, and in the form of a pdf demo which shows a basic version of what it might look like. I am hoping to continue to develop this idea and hopefully work on properly creating the game.
